Aging Infrastructure and Equipment
The aging infrastructure of energy transmission and distribution systems is a critical driver for the Energy Transmission and Distribution Equipment MRO Services Market. Many regions are grappling with outdated equipment that requires frequent maintenance and upgrades. As these systems age, the likelihood of failures increases, prompting energy providers to invest in MRO services to ensure reliability and safety. The need for refurbishment and replacement of aging components is likely to drive the market, as utilities seek to modernize their infrastructure. This trend presents a substantial opportunity for MRO service providers to offer solutions that enhance the performance and lifespan of existing equipment.
Technological Advancements in Equipment
Technological advancements are significantly influencing the Energy Transmission and Distribution Equipment MRO Services Market. Innovations in equipment design and monitoring technologies have led to improved efficiency and reliability in energy transmission and distribution. The integration of smart technologies, such as IoT and predictive maintenance tools, allows for real-time monitoring and proactive maintenance strategies. This shift towards advanced technologies not only enhances operational efficiency but also reduces the overall costs associated with MRO services. As energy companies adopt these technologies, the demand for specialized MRO services is expected to rise, creating new opportunities within the market.
Regulatory Compliance and Safety Standards
Regulatory compliance plays a crucial role in the Energy Transmission and Distribution Equipment MRO Services Market. Governments and regulatory bodies impose stringent safety standards to ensure the reliability and safety of energy infrastructure. Compliance with these regulations necessitates regular maintenance and inspection of equipment, thereby driving the demand for MRO services. The increasing focus on safety and environmental regulations compels energy companies to invest in MRO services to avoid penalties and ensure operational integrity. As a result, the market for MRO services is likely to expand, as companies seek to adhere to evolving regulatory frameworks and maintain high safety standards.

Growing Focus on Renewable Energy Integration
The transition towards renewable energy sources is reshaping the Energy Transmission and Distribution Equipment MRO Services Market. As more renewable energy projects come online, the existing transmission and distribution infrastructure must adapt to accommodate these new energy sources. This integration requires specialized MRO services to ensure that equipment can handle the variability and unique characteristics of renewable energy. The increasing investment in renewable energy infrastructure is likely to drive demand for MRO services, as energy companies seek to optimize their systems for efficiency and reliability. This trend not only supports the growth of the MRO market but also aligns with broader sustainability goals.
